FACTS 2010

Total sales 2010: 2.560 billion €

12000 employees

134 production sites in 37 different countries

One of the largest global rigid packaging manufacturer

CUSTOMISATION EXAMPLE

Steps through an EBM to Top Load Simulation - Overview

Bottle CAD model

Create parison with assumptions

Extrusion Blow Molding simulation to estimate the wall thickness

Mapping the thickness to the bottle

Check of the weight and distribution

Top load simulation

Results comparison with hardware bottle if avalible

Steps through an EBM to Top Load Simulation - mapping

Mapping the thickness to the bottle

Check of the weight and distribution

Work

flow

Result from EBM simulation

Thickness for Top Load simulation

Currently “Results Mapper” does not support Radioss A00* files

Solution

Automatic export of nodal coordinates, element connectivity and element thickness values from Hyperview into *.csv file

Import of *.csv files into Hyperworks

Mapping of thickness

Interactive with GUI

In batch mode (5 times faster)

CONCLUSION

What´s behind all this - TCL

Simple and programmable syntax

Can be used as standalone application or embedded in programs

Open source

Interpreted language

New TCL commands can be implemented using C language

CONCLUSION

Customisation of Hyperworks is not as difficult as it seems to be

Huge time savings in modelling repeating tasks can be measured

Consistence of simulation models from different users is given

New team members will be guided to defined tasks

They become more familiar with simulation processes within a shorter time period

Help can be found at

http://www.tcl.tk/

../hw11.0/help/hwdref/hwdref.htm

Review your command.cmf

Every mouse click in Hypermesh is written into this file

Use macro to convert these lines into TCL language for Hypermesh

Copy paste into new file
